Diodorus Siculus: Historical Library The “Historical Library” of Diodorus Siculus is a detailed account of Greek and Roman history down to the author’s own time (about 60 B.C.). Unfortunately the second half (books 21-40) has only survived in fragments, but even these fragments represent one of the most important sources for the history of the period that they cover.
Diodorus Siculus, Greek historian of Agyrium in Sicily, ca. 80–20 BCE, wrote forty books of world history, called Library of History, in three parts: mythical history of peoples, non-Greek and Greek, to the Trojan War; history to Alexander’s death (323 BCE); history to 54 BCE.

Diodorus’ universal history, which he named Bibliotheca historica (Greek: Ἱστορικὴ Βιβλιοθήκη, “Historical Library”), was immense and consisted of 40 books, of which 1–5 and 11–20 survive: fragments of the lost books are preserved in Photius and the excerpts of Constantine Porphyrogenitus.

Diodorus’s Library of History, written in the first century BCE, is the most extensively preserved history by an ancient Greek author. The work is in three parts: mythical history to the Trojan War; history to Alexander’s death (323 BCE); and history to 54 BCE. Books 1-5 and 11-20 survive complete, the rest in fragments.
